Default Our "jobs"

This was originally on another post that didn't get many hits, so I thought I'd share some Yorkie occupations with you. What do your Yorkies do for a living?




Scruffy (RIP) was Sargeant Scruffy aka Scruff-man, Winkie-man, Scruff-Puff, etc. He would rat out Cinder everytime she came near the little ones water bowl. He also liked to call OnStar and get directions to Super Fresh for carrots, etc.

Gracie (RIP) was a radio talk show host and always answered the phone with "Dis is Gwacie, how tan I help?" She also ran the household, the neighborhood, and generally any group in which she found herself! She loved malls, Chinese restaurants and pink leather. She never played with a toy in her life!

Miss Lexy Marie (whom you all may identify as Wexy) works for Toys R Us as a toy tester. She loves to play with toys of all kinds! She has a side job as a urine tester for Congoleum. They wanted to know how many times a floor could be peed on without wearing out. She is still working on that assignment and expecting a huge bonus in '06. Lexy, in her spare time, is learning that drywall and woodwork belong on the wall and not in your mouth. She aspires to be an all natural girl and have dreadlocks, but that is not to be. One must suffer to be beautiful at times. Often, her dreams of grandeur include turning into a "bwack Wab." Don't anyone tell her she is short and only 2 1/2 lbs. ok? We don't want to break her spirit!!

Since Layla (black Lab) was sprung from da joint, she has been having trouble adjusting to life on the outside. As many ex-cons will attest, freedom can require a big adjustment. She has only broken parole once, and luckily got back before the cops found out. Like Martha Stewart, Layla must wear an electronic device at all times to ensure her whereabouts. Occupational therapy for Layla includes, eating any and all potted plants and their containers, strength testing the thin plastic grill cover, smearing snot on the glass back door, and generally keeping our yard resembling a war zone. Layla is still working on her kleptomania that got her in trouble in the first place. Some of Lexy's toys seem to find their way to the yard and get returned missing limbs, eyes, etc. Perhaps Layla is training for a new life as a Voodoo priestess.

Cinder (black Lab) is currently enjoying semi-retirement from her career as a security agent. The country owes a great debt to Cinder for keeping those pesky UPS people in line all these years. She also gives much needed job training to garbage men and meter readers. In her leisure time, Cinder enjoys babysitting, swimming and cookouts. Recently she became a home owner and is busy decorating and landscaping. She is available for consultation MWF 8:00 to 10:00 a.m., but never works weekends and holidays anymore. She is in high demand and appointments are recommended.

Well, Desi (upon receiving her Phd. diploma from the University of PetSmart) has embarked on a career as " Executive Food Analyst". Her main demanding role is to pre-taste all family food consumption and determine its eligibility for distribution amoung her family unit. This hazardous assignment requires her to stand by the dinner table and stare intently at each individual, until a sample of food is given to her for analysis. Once the "all clear" is given everyone can resume their comsumption. She executes her responsibilities with enthusiasm, proffessionalizm and takes great pride in assuring the well fare of all under her charge.
